In order of release
Name/Start Year/Animation Studio
Transformers (AKA Transformers G1) -1984, Toei Animation
The Transformers, The Movie-1986, Toei Animation
Transformers: The Headmasters-1987, Toei Animation
Transformers: Masterforce-1988, Toei Animation
Transformers: Victory-1989, Toei Animation
Transformers: Zone-1990, Toei Animation (planned as an ongoing series but only one episode was produced)
Transformers: Generation 2-1991, Toei Animation
Beast Wars: Transformers-1996, Mainframe Entertainment
Beast Wars II- 1998, Ashi Production
Beast Wars: Transformers Special-1998, Ashi Production
Beast Wars Neo-1999, Ashi Production
Beast Machines- 2000, Mainframe Entertainment
Transformers: Robots In Disguise-2000, Studio Gallop
Transformers: Armada 2002, Actas Inc.
Transformers: Energon-2004, Actas Inc.
Transformers: Cybertron-2005, Gonzo
*Transformers-2007, DreamWorks
Transformers: Animated-2008, The Answer Studio
*Transformers: Revenge of the Fallen-2009, DreamWorks
Transformers: Prime-2010, Polygon Pictures
*Transformers: Dark of the Moon-2011, DreamWorks
Transformers: Rescue Bots-2011, Atomic Cartoons
*Transformers 4-2013. DreamWorks
(*indicates live action film)
There have, in the last decade, been several Transformers short series, these were for the most part released directly to the internet or DVD
Transformers: Robot Masters-2004, Takara Tomy (2 short episodes direct to Region 2 DVD in Japan, Holds the distintion of being the only instance of Optimus Prime, Optimus Primal, and Leo Prime all fighting side by side against Megatron and Megatron 2 also fighting side by side!)
Beast Wars: Transformers: The Theft of the Golden Disc (see Beast Wars episode 0, Prequel to Beast Wars, first aired at a Transformers Botcon convention, has since been released on the internet VIA YouTube. This was a canon addition to Beast Wars)
Transformers Animated Shorts-2008/2009, The Answer (11 short episodes, first released as extras on DVD releases of Transformers Animated)
